acadia-newlib/newlib/libc/machine
Mike Frysinger 44f6310bf9 newlib: libc: include all chapters all the time in the manual
THe stdio subdir is actually required by the documentation.  The
stdio/def is handled dynamically, but libc.texi always expects it
to be included, and fails if it isn't.  So making it required when
building docs is safe.

The xdr subdir is handled dynamically, but it doesn't include any
docs, so the dynamic logic isn't (currently) adding any value.  So
making it required when building docs is safe.

That leaves: iconv, stdio64, posix, and signal subdirs.  The chapters
have a little disclaimer saying they are system-dependent, but even
then, imo having stable manuals regardless of the target is preferable,
and we can add more disclaimer language to these chapters if we want.

This doesn't touch the man page codepaths, just the info/pdf.
2022-02-04 19:39:09 -05:00
..
a29k new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
aarch64 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
amdgcn new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
arc new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
arm new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
bfin new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
cr16 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
cris new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
crx new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
csky new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
d10v new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
d30v new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
epiphany new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
fr30 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
frv new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
ft32 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
h8300 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
h8500 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
hppa new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
i386 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
i960 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
iq2000 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
lm32 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
m32c new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
m32r new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
m68hc11 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
m68k new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
m88k new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
mep new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
microblaze new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
mips new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
mn10200 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
mn10300 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
moxie new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
msp430 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
mt new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
nds32 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
necv70 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
nios2 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
nvptx new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
or1k new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
powerpc new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
pru new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
riscv new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
rl78 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
rx new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
sh new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
shared_x86/sys Cygwin: don't export _feinitialise from newlib 2021-04-13 12:55:34 +02:00
sparc new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
spu new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
tic4x new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
tic6x new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
tic80 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
v850 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
visium new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
w65 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
x86_64 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
xc16x new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
xscale newlib: libc: merge machine/ configure scripts up a level 2022-01-26 03:11:21 -05:00
xstormy16 new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00
z8k newlib: libc: include all chapters all the time in the manual 2022-02-04 19:39:09 -05:00